1# $MirOS: src/share/doc/usd/21.troff/Makefile,v 1.1.7.1 2005/03/06 16:17:47 tg Exp $
2# @(#)Makefile	6.4 (Berkeley) 6/30/90
3
4DIR=	usd/21.troff
5INTRO=	m0
6TUTOR=	m0a
7PAPER=	m1 m2 m3 m4
8APNDX1=	m5
9APNDX2=	table1
10APNDX3=	table2
11MACROS=	m.mac
12EXTRA=	${INTRO} ${TUTOR} ${PAPER} ${APNDX1} ${APNDX2} ${APNDX3} ${MACROS} add
13
14paper.ps: intro.${PRINTER} tutor.${PRINTER} apndx1.${PRINTER} \
15	apndx2.${PRINTER} apndx3.${PRINTER} add.${PRINTER}
16	${TBL} ${PAPER} | ${ROFF} - | \
17		cat intro.${PRINTER} tutor.${PRINTER} - apndx1.${PRINTER} \
18		apndx2.${PRINTER} apndx3.${PRINTER} add.${PRINTER} >${.TARGET}
19
20intro.${PRINTER}: ${INTRO}
21	${ROFF} ${INTRO} >${.TARGET}
22
23tutor.${PRINTER}: ${TUTOR}
24	${TBL} ${TUTOR} | ${ROFF} - >${.TARGET}
25
26apndx1.${PRINTER}: ${APNDX1}
27	${ROFF} ${APNDX1} >${.TARGET}
28
29apndx2.${PRINTER}: ${APNDX2}
30	${ROFF} ${APNDX2} >${.TARGET}
31
32apndx3.${PRINTER}: ${APNDX3}
33	${ROFF} ${APNDX3} >${.TARGET}
34
35add.${PRINTER}: add
36	${ROFF} add >${.TARGET}
37
38clean:
39	rm -f intro.* tutor.* paper.* \
40	    apndx1.* apndx2.* apndx3.* add.* \
41	    *.spell errs Errs make.out
42
43spell: ${INTRO} ${TUTOR} ${PAPER} ${APNDX1} ${APNDX2} ${APNDX3}
44	@for i in ${INTRO} ${TUTOR} ${PAPER} ${APNDX1} ${APNDX2} ${APNDX3}; do \
45		echo $$i; spell $$i | sort | comm -23 - spell.ok >$$i.spell; \
46	done
47
48.include <bsd.doc.mk>
49